TriStar’s Lindsay Sloane Joins MGM Television as Production & Development EVP

TriStar’s Lindsay Sloane has joined MGM Television as executive vice president, Television Production & Development. She was the head of TV for her now-former employer.

Additionally, Max Kisbye has been promoted to senior vice president in the same department. He’ll continue to oversee FX’s “Fargo” from that post. The Production & Development unit is led by Roma Khanna, president, Television Group and Digital. MGM also has “Teen Wolf” and “Vikings” currently on TV.

Other internal MGM moves include Nathan Taylor’s elevation from creative executive to director of Development, and Rob Hochberg being upped from executive assistant to creative executive.

“Lindsay comes aboard during a tremendous period of growth for MGM TV,” said Steve Stark, MGM’s president, Production & Development. “Our television business is thriving as we continue to develop high quality content that appeals to the global audience. Lindsay, through her strong relationships and keen instinct for quality programming, will be a wonderful addition to our incredible team of executives. “

Sloane will report in to Stark. In her new job, Sloane will be responsible for creating and developing new projects, working alongside Kisbye and the rest of the television team.

“MGM Television has quickly become a major force in the television industry, known for its quality content, compelling storytelling and high caliber talent,” added Sloane. “I’m excited to jump right in with Steve, Max and the rest of the amazing team on the creation and development of new series.”
